1. Working Out

I know, I know. This is that wake up call, we all strived to reach that goal summer body with our good friends at school trying to support one another and we are getting so close! If you don't have a gym membership, usually gyms offer a 7-day free trial or something similar! Also having a Costco membership offers a deal with 24 Hour Fitness, or just simply finding a gym that eases your wallet into a transition is available!

3. Explore your city

Google is your best friend this summer. Search "Events near (your city)" and endless opportunities will arise before you! Adding in the word "free" doesn't hurt either! Free art festivals in nearby parks, ferry tours of a beautiful city, fishing, or even renting out a cabin can help you explore that backyard territory you had no idea that existed. Another rising hot topic is Geocaching! Going to a walking path, a beach or walking on a side walk in your town will show you plenty of cool treasures! Look at the App Store if your phone is capable!

6. Spontaneous

If all else fails, or you discover that those aren't just feeding your summer needs, do something out of the box. Follow your favorite musician around to large cities, or take that drive to California that you and your best friend have always wanted to do. Hostels and Airbnb are cheap travel tools to site see and have fun on a college budget! Or visit WWOOF USA to find places to volunteer on organic farms as they pay for your accommodations. There is always a way!
